Hopkins's works are typically Victorian in that their primary purpose is to advocate social and economic reform.
eimsori [14]
The answer is False.

Gerard Manley Hopkins was a Victorian poet, but he wrote mostly about nature and God.

Chemical properties of the soil
lianna [129]

Answer:

Soil chemical properties, including<u> </u><u>heavy metal concentrations, pH, total carbon, total nitrogen, CEC, exchangeable calcium (Ca), magnesium (Mg) and potassium (K), exchangeable Al</u><u> </u>and hydrogen (H) and available phosphorous (P), were determined following standard laboratory methods.
